Thanks guys! This was my 1st full set of passes at close to sealevel on the new combo. We were on a slick track, and foot braking. Boost was up pretty good at 26 psi but timing at a conservative 14 deg. Hopefully a good trans brake launch and a little timing will do the trick! In case no one is familiar with new combo changes are:

-Same Iron block honed .005'' over bore.
-JFR custom Autotec daily driver series pistons
-STD Callies H beam rods
-Same stock crank
-JFR 224 camshaft
-Arp main studs
-Mild ported TFS As cast 220 heads, bronze guide version running stock rockers.
-Gangsta V3 S476/96 1.25 T4.
-Firecore50 plug and play replacement truck coils, and wires.

Still running the KB log manifold, early truck intake, stock TB, full exh , air to air I/C, etc.

Yes before I was blowing out spark after about 23 psi. The holley HP is a great system but it does not work well with stock coils and high boost. Not sure why but I've fired up to 25 psi with .026'' + gap on my factory ecu truck with stock coils with no problem.
